A survivor on the Aeroflot flight that killed 41 people after bursting into flames on landing at a Moscow airport has complained about not getting a refund.
Crash survivor Dmitry Khlebushkin told Russian media Aeroflot was “unprofessional” in the handling of the incident.
“I failed to get a refund for my ticket for 40 minutes,” he reportedly said. “And in the end I did not get it at all.”
The passenger, who was reportedly seated in row 10, has also been targeted on Russian aviation online forum Forumavia, where footage has been shared of him escaping the plane holding his backpack.

He has been accused of “blocking” others from escaping the burning aircraft when he evacuated with his bag, although it is not known whether his bag was in the overhead lockers or by his feet, where he may have been able to easily pick it up.
